Description
The Perfect Misses Dress from 1940. Style I has a double collar and a
slide fastener trims the front. Flaps below the shoulder and at the hip
line make a decorative trimming. Long sleeves are darted at the top.
Style II has short sleeves, pleated at the bottom and darted at the top.
A single collar used.
Suggested fabrics
Style I: Bengaline, Hop-sacking weaves, moss crepe,
novelty silk, wool jersey, sheer wool.
Style II: Plain or printed: Cottons, Linen, Shantung,
Spun rayons, Rayon crepe, Silk crepe.
To fit: Bust 36 ins. – Waist 30 ins. – Hip 39 ins.
The pattern comes with instructions and a helpful sewing guide.
Skill level: Advanced Beginner
